陆地棉ZF-HD蛋白的全基因组分析

摘    要:ZF-HD(Zinc finger-homeodomain)蛋白属于同源异型盒蛋白家族,在动植物发育过程中起重要的作用。利用生物信息学的手段,研究陆地棉标准系TM-1基因组中ZF-HD蛋白的数目、亚细胞定位、染色体分布、基序、进化关系和组织表达情况。TM-1中共有35个Gh ZHD蛋白成员,且大部分成员定位到细胞核内;分布在20条染色体和2条Scaffold上,且具有11对直系同源基因;进化树分析表明,TM-1基因组中的ZF-HD蛋白大致分为6个小组,每个小组成员间具有类似的基序类型和排列顺序;大部分Gh ZHD基因在胚珠和纤维组织中表达,还有部分基因在根、茎、花、蕾和分生区中表达,在叶和愈伤组织中表达的基因最少。

Genome-Wide Analysis of the GhZHD Protein Family in Upland Cotton

Abstract:The Zinc finger-homeodomain (ZF-HD) protein family of homeobox genes plays a vital role during the development processes of plants and animals. The number, subcellular localization, chromosome distribution, motif, evolutionary relationships and tissue-expression patterns of the ZF-HD protein family were studied in the genome of Gossypium hirsutum L. acc. 'TM-1' using bioinformatics methods. In total, 35 GhZHD genes were identified in the 'TM-1' genome, and a majority of the members are located in nucleus. The family members were distributed on 20 chromosomes and two scaffolds, and 11 pairs were orthologous genes. The family could be divided into six groups based on the phylogenetic analysis, and there were similar motif types and arrangements in each group. Most GhZHD genes were expressed in ovules and fibers, some were expressed in roots, stems, buds and flowers, and a fraction were expressed in leaves and calli.
